How the Verizon Prepaid Sim Card Actually Works
The Verizon Prepaid Sim Card operates on a simple, access-driven model: insert the card into any eligible Verizon smartphone, activate using basic instructions, and begin using data, texts, and calls without signing a monthly agreement. Prepaid plans include customizable data tiers and affordable minutes, letting users adjust consumption as circumstances change. Charges are assessed in advance—no collections, no surprise bills—making budgeting predictable and stress-free. This model appeals to users who value autonomy and want to avoid the obligation of recurring payments, especially in times of economic uncertainty.

How Do I Activate a Verizon Prepaid Sim Card?
Activation is straightforward: insert the SIM into your device, enter your account details via the Verizon app or physical controls, and you’re connected within minutes. No credit check or contract required—ideal for new or cautious users.
